Lt.-Col. Robert Esme Berkeley1 
He was educated at Wellington College, Crowthorne, Berkshire, EnglandG.1 He was educated at Royal Military College, Sandhurst, Berkshire, EnglandG.1 He fought in the Boer War between 1899 and 1902.1 He gained the rank of Lieutenant-Colonel in the 2nd Battalion, Loyal Regiment.1 He fought in the First World War, where he was mentioned in desptaches.1 He was awarded the Distinguished Service Order (D.S.O.)1 He lived in 1952 at 12 Broomfield Court, Sunningdale, Berkshire, EnglandG.1
